What is the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form?
The A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form is designed for AmeriHealth New Jersey members to request and authorize the administration of injectable vaccines. This form is crucial for individuals seeking vaccinations, ensuring that members can navigate the medical authorization process smoothly. It provides a structured approach to facilitate the administration of prescribed vaccines, thus enhancing patient care.

Key Features of the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form
The A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form includes several essential features critical for both members and physicians. Key aspects of the form are:
-
Multiple fillable fields, including member name, address, and physician’s information.
-
Clear instructions for completing each section, ensuring users can easily navigate the form.
-
A requirement for dual signatures from both the member and the physician for validation.
These features not only enhance usability but also ensure compliance with necessary health regulations.

How to Fill Out the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form Online
Filling out the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form online can be accomplished by following these steps:
-
Access pdfFiller to locate the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form.
-
Enter the member's name and address in the respective fields.
-
Provide the date of birth and relevant physician details.
-
Specify the vaccine drug name, strength, and diagnosis code.
-
Ensure both signatures are documented at the designated signature lines.
This structured approach simplifies the form-filling process while ensuring that all necessary information is correctly captured.

Who is eligible to use the AmeriHealth New Jersey Vaccine Program Form?
This form is designed for AmeriHealth New Jersey members who need to request authorization for prescribed injectable vaccines. Both members and their physicians must sign the form.
Are there any deadlines for submitting this vaccine authorization form?
While specific deadlines aren't detailed, it is advisable to submit the form as soon as possible to avoid delays in vaccine administration. Check with your healthcare provider for any urgency regarding vaccination.
How can I submit the AmeriHealth Vaccine Form after filling it out?
You can submit the completed form by utilizing the submit options on pdfFiller. Alternatively, you can download the completed form and send it via email or postal service to the appropriate healthcare provider or insurance company.
What supporting documents are required with the vaccine program form?
Generally, supporting documentation might include a physician's prescription and personal identification of the member. Check with your healthcare provider for any specific requirements.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ure all personal and physician details are entered accurately. Common mistakes include omitting signatures, missing required fields, and providing incorrect vaccine information. Double-check all entries before submission.
How long does it take to process the AmeriHealth Vaccine Program Form?
Processing times can vary. Generally, it may take a few days to a week for the authorization to be reviewed. For more urgent cases, consult with your physician or healthcare provider regarding any expedited options.
